Reinventing the Steel is the ninth and final studio album by American heavy metal band Pantera, released on March 21, 2000, March 27 in the UK and April 5 in Japan, through Elektra Records and East West Records. This was the last studio album Pantera released before their 19 year breakup from November 2003 to July 2022. Further, it is the band's final album to feature the Abbott brothers Dimebag Darrell and Vinnie Paul before their deaths in 2004 and 2018, respectively.
